Performance and Heat Output

The Flymo 2000W Patio Heater uses quartz heating elements to provide instant warmth. Owner reviews consistently praise its ability to heat a 15-20 square meter area effectively, even on cooler evenings. The three heat settings (low, medium, high) allow users to adjust the temperature based on the ambient conditions. The heater is most effective when placed close to the seating area, as the heat is directional. Some users note that it struggles in windy conditions, which is typical for electric patio heaters.

Build Quality and Design

Flymo has constructed this heater with a durable metal housing and a stable base. The design is functional rather than decorative, with a focus on practicality. The heater is relatively lightweight at 4.5 kg, making it easy to move around the garden. The included safety features, such as an automatic shut-off if tipped over, are a welcome addition. The overall build quality is solid, with most owner reviews reporting no issues with the unit after several months of use.

What to Check Before Buying a Patio Heater

Before purchasing, consider the size of your patio. Measure the area you want to heat and ensure the heater's coverage matches. Check the power source: electric heaters need a nearby outdoor socket, while gas heaters require a gas canister. Also, think about portability: if you plan to move the heater, a lightweight model with wheels is beneficial. Finally, review the warranty and customer support options.

Mistakes to Avoid When Buying a Patio Heater

A common mistake is underestimating the impact of wind. Electric heaters are less effective in breezy conditions, so consider a windbreak or a gas heater if your patio is exposed. Another error is choosing a heater with insufficient heat output for the space. Always match the wattage to the square meterage. Lastly, avoid models with poor build quality, as they may not withstand outdoor conditions.
